Transaction 684546fa025cfcaac04315ffbbc209704b61b4b45026c368a01008eeafd194be
1 Input
1 Output
-
684546fa025cfcaac04315ffbbc209704b61b4b45026c368a01008eeafd194be:0
- value
- 941912257
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 184fe860374f181045095d3424c6ec63c479ec92 OP_EQUAL
- address
- 33uZsEUzPHxtoGUyo9tvWT1wM33PA3BjCm